On 2021-02-16 3:32 p.m., Dekatron42 wrote: > I've had similar problems with two Russian CRT's and I had to use > scalpel to cut them loose and then carefully peel them off as they had > almost fused to the glass, probably from the plastizicer had evaporated > but also left a thin film on the glass that worked almost like glue. > > I tried to put them in warm water to soften them but I was afraid that > they would shrink and crush the tube so I didn't use water that was > hotter than from the water tap at home and that was not enough. >
Hi Martin, Thanks, that's very helpful, not least the reassurance that "it's not just me". I imagine that getting them off was something of a carving operation. It definitely feels "fused".
